Book Synopsis



A simmering, provocative novel about a couple whose affair with a young Greek woman over the course of a summer in Athens threatens to crack their relationship wide open

"The type of book you'll want to gulp down in one breathless sitting . . . A summer in Athens? Check. Millennial malaise? Check. A steamy affair that upends everything? Check. . . . Taylor mixes literary musings with juicy plot twists and plenty of interpersonal drama."--The Guardian

IN DEVELOPMENT AS A FEATURE FILM STARRING SEBASTIAN STAN AND VANESSA KIRBY

At a crossroads in their lives, a couple arrives in Greece to house-sit for a friend. Emma is searching for a meaningful next step beyond work or starting a family, and Julian is struggling to come to terms with the failure of his academic career. Their visions for the future seem to be pulling them in different directions, and they hope that this summer away will help them mend their frayed connection.

Emma and Julian's plans take an unexpected turn when they meet Lena, an enigmatic young Greek woman, who presents an opportunity for them to explore their relationship in uncharted and excitingly risky ways. However, as the heat in the city grows stifling, Emma and Julian find themselves far more entangled in Lena's life than they'd bargained for. Engaged in a three-way struggle for control, Emma, Julian, and Lena are suddenly faced with consequences far greater--and far more explosive--than they could have predicted.

Voyeuristic and thrilling, Ruins delivers the drama of a modern Greek tragedy while exposing the tensions between privilege and power, desire and intimacy.

About the Author



Amy Taylor is a writer based in Naarm/Melbourne. She is the author of Ruins and Search History, which was shortlisted for the Readings Prize for New Australian Fiction and named as one of The Guardian's Top Australian Books of the Year. Both of her novels are currently in development to be adapted for the screen.
